About Me
I'm Drew, a software developer and data engineer based in Tulsa, Oklahoma. My work lives at the intersection of data engineering and full-stack development — I build systems that move, transform, and surface data, as well as the web applications that make that data useful to real people.
What drives me is the satisfaction of turning complexity into something clean and dependable. Whether that's an ETL pipeline processing millions of records reliably, or a web app that just works the way users expect, I care about getting the details right. I like problems that are messy at the start and crisp at the end.
Outside of work, I spend time outdoors when I can — hiking, running and staying active help me reset. I'm also a genuine tech enthusiast; I tinker with side projects, keep up with what's moving in the data and AI space, and enjoy the craft of building things that didn't exist before. I graduated from Pittsburg State University in 2022 and have been building in the real world ever since.
Experience
Technologies & Tools
- Modernized critical educational infrastructure by rewriting a legacy application in Blazor, serving 15,000 teachers across Kansas, significantly improving system performance, maintainability, and user experience.
- Architected and deployed data pipeline processing 1.3M orders, 580K customers, and 30M custom field records from legacy application to BigCommerce API while managing rate limits and maintaining pipeline observability through comprehensive metadata tracking.
- Led migration from legacy custom platform to BigCommerce SaaS, designing ETL processes for data transformation and validation across SQL Server databases.
- Built and maintained serverless applications using Next.js, integrated with AWS S3 for cloud storage solutions.
- Developed automated CI/CD pipelines using GitHub Actions for continuous deployment.
- Served as primary client liaison, regularly conducting status updates and discovery meetings with stakeholders to gather requirements, communicate project progress, and ensure alignment between technical deliverables and business objectives.
Technologies & Tools
- Designed and implemented ETL pipelines consuming end-of-day files from 1,000+ POS systems, processing data into PostgreSQL and Azure SQL databases.
- Built distributed event streaming architecture using Apache Kafka for real-time ticket data processing and RabbitMQ for reliable message queuing in data workflows.
- Developed batch processing systems handling high-volume data transformation with fault tolerance and retry mechanisms.
- Leveraged expertise in Vue.js and JavaScript to architect user interfaces while spearheading backend development utilizing Python and PostgreSQL.
- Utilized Azure cloud services, including Azure Functions and Azure Data Factory, to design and implement data pipelines for efficient data processing, transformation, and analysis workflows.
Technologies & Tools
- Developed interactive and optimized dashboards using Power BI and Microsoft SQL Server, providing valuable insights to the head pricing analysts and streamlining their analysis processes.
- Designed and implemented an automated data fetching program, resulting in significant time savings of approximately 15 minutes per day for the team.
- Utilized advanced Microsoft Excel techniques for data cleaning and conducted comprehensive analysis on customers and carriers within their databases, enabling data-driven decision-making.
Skills & Tools
Languages
Frameworks & Platforms
Data & Databases
Cloud & DevOps
How I Work
Data-First Thinking
Good software starts with understanding the data. Every system I build is designed to make data reliable, traceable, and actionable — because decisions are only as good as what they're built on.
Practical Over Perfect
I favor clean, working solutions over over-engineered ones. Shipping something solid and maintainable beats perfecting something nobody uses. I keep things simple until complexity earns its place.
Continuous Learning
The tools change fast. I stay sharp by building side projects, reading broadly across data and software engineering, and staying genuinely curious about what's coming next.
Education
Bachelor of Business Administration — Information Technology
Pittsburg State University
Class of 2022
Want to work together or just say hi?
You
Get in Touch